Grilled Flank Steak with Chimichurri Sauce
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 15 Minutes
Cook Time: 25 Minutes
Ready In: 40 Minutes
Servings: 4
Ingredients:
olive oil cooking spray
1 pound(s) flank steak, about 3/4-inch thick fat trimmed
1/2 teaspoon(s) fine sea salt
1/4 cup(s) nonfat plain greek-style yogurt
2 tablespoon(s) red wine vinegar
1 tablespoon(s) extra-virgin olive oil
1 tablespoon(s) low-sodium vegetable broth
20 sprig(s) fresh flat-leaf parsley
5 sprig(s) fresh oregano leaves from
4 clove(s) garlic
1/2 teaspoon(s) red pepper flakes
1/4 teaspoon(s) fine sea salt divided
Directions:
1. Grilled Flank Steak:
2. Preheat grill to high heat and lightly mist grate with spray. Sprinkle steak with salt. Grill to desired doneness, about 4 minutes per side for medium-rare or 5 minutes per side for medium. Remove steak from grill and let rest, loosely covered with foil, for 5 minutes. Cut steak across the grain diagonally into thin slices.
3. Chimichurri Sauce:
4. Place all ingredients into a food processor fitted with a standard blade. Process to form a pesto-like sauce, scraping down the bowl as necessary.
